Ingredients
– 8 ounces fettuccine or pasta of your choice
– 1 pound large shrimp, peeled and deveined
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– 4 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 cup heavy cream
– 1 cup chicken broth
– 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es (adjust to taste)
– 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
–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
– Juice of 1 lemon
Instructions
Creating Marry Me Shrimp Pasta is straightforward if you follow these simple steps:
1. Cook the Pasta: In a large pot of boiling salted water, cook the pasta according to package directions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
2. Sauté the Shrimp: In a large skillet over medium heat, add olive oil. Once hot, add the shrimp and season with salt and pepper. Cook for 2-3 minutes, flipping halfway, until shrimp are pink and opaque. Remove from skillet and set aside.
3. Sauté Garlic: In the same skillet, add minced garlic and red pepper flakes. S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
4. Add Cream and Broth: Pour in the heavy cream and chicken broth. Stir to combine and bring to a simmer.
5. Season the Sauce: Add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per to taste. Let the sauce simmer for 5 minutes, allowing it to thicken slightly.
6. Combine Pasta and Shrimp: Return the cooked shrimp to the skillet along with the drained pasta. Toss everything together until the pasta is well coated with the sauce.
7. Stir in Cheese: Gradually add the grated Parmesan cheese, stirring constantly until melted and creamy.
8. Finish with Lemon Juice: Squeeze in the juice of one lemon and give it a final stir to combine.
9. Garnish: Remove from heat, garnish with chopped parsley, and additional cheese if desired.
